A food web shows the complex interactions and interconnectedness among different organisms in an ecosystem, including the flow of energy and nutrients through the community. It provides a more comprehensive understanding of the feeding relationships within an ecosystem compared to a simple food chain, which only shows a linear transfer of energy from one organism to another.
A food web shows multiple interconnected food chains within an ecosystem, including the various feeding relationships among organisms. It provides a more realistic representation of the complex interactions and interdependencies among different species in an ecosystem compared to a linear food chain. This complexity better reflects the actual flow of energy and nutrients within the ecosystem.

A food web is a diagram that shows the feeding relationships among organisms in an ecosystem. It consists of interconnected food chains that illustrate how energy and nutrients flow through the ecosystem via predator-prey interactions. The food web highlights the complex and dynamic nature of ecological relationships in a given habitat.
